## Configuration

FuelTally builds the weekly fleet fuel-usage report for Marrowgate Logistics. Copy `env.sample` to `.env` before release. Set `FUELTALLY_REGION` to the depot code, `FUELTALLY_CUTOFF_DAY` to the reporting cutoff (default Sunday), and `FUELTALLY_OUTPUT` to the report drop path. The telemetry warehouse rejects unauthenticated pulls, so the warehouse credential is mandatory. Add that credential on the line immediately below.

sealed setting: ARCHIVE_KEY3=8d0

## Deployment

The Quillhaven worker now ships as a slimmed container image. We moved to a multi-stage build, dropped the debug toolchain, and trimmed locale data, cutting the image from 1.2 GB to 140 MB. Cold-start times in the Bramfield cluster dropped accordingly. The build pipeline pins all base layers by digest. The runtime settings baked into the release image are shown below.

deployment values, faduf-tawep:
SORDOR_LOG_LEVEL=error
SORDOR_METRICS_HOST=metrics.sordor.nelvrolabs.internal
SORDOR_POOL_SIZE=4

## Ticket: Config drift between KitePost SDKs

Hey plugin folks — we've confirmed the Swift and Kotlin SDKs for KitePost have drifted. The Kotlin client defaults to gzip on uploads and a 15s timeout; Swift still ships deflate and 30s, which explains the parity bugs several of you reported with retry hooks. We're aligning both SDKs to a single canonical config next release, so plugins should stop hardcoding workarounds. The agreed canonical values are listed below.

service settings:
[casax]
port = 6379
team = rusir
host = casax.zemvarhq.corp
region = outer-4
access_code = ac_9808ce
timeout_ms = 1500